Output b91569808087fc9102ae5c23a0eeace3b58f94d5a19d79a1d2eb378113dda88f:1

value
5902900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 708951bb4f44f208a4324f1ad6ce12415eb05d56 OP_EQUAL
address
3Bx478zDo195WJ4gezcVm4XxowK8YVSWfc
transaction
b91569808087fc9102ae5c23a0eeace3b58f94d5a19d79a1d2eb378113dda88f
confirmations
273646
spent
true